WebJul 14, 2024 · Travelling to Ireland from any other area. Since Sunday 6 March 2024, travellers to Ireland are not required to show proof of vaccination, proof of recovery or a negative PCR test result upon arrival. There are no post-arrival testing or quarantine requirements for travellers to Ireland. WebApr 11, 2024 · The standard of medical facilities in the UK is good. We have a reciprocal healthcare agreement with the UK. Some GP and hospital treatments are free if you're in the UK for a short visit. If you stay more than 6 months, you'll pay a surcharge when applying for your visa.
